Custard Pie With Praline Sauce

Description

A comforting homemade custard pie topped with a sweet and crunchy praline sauce.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 Pie Crust (store-bought or homemade)
  • 4 large Eggs
  • 2 cups Whole Milk
  • 3/4 cup Granulated Sugar
  • 1 tsp Vanilla Extract
  • 1/4 cup Butter (melted)
  • 1 cup Chopped Nuts (Pecans or Walnuts)


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
  2. If using a homemade crust, roll it out, fit it into your pie dish, and pre-bake for 10 minutes until lightly golden.
  3. Whisk together the eggs, milk, sugar, and vanilla in a mixing bowl until combined.
  4. Add melted butter and mix well.
  5. Carefully pour the custard mixture into the pre-baked crust.
  6. Bake for approximately 35 to 40 minutes until the custard is set but slightly jiggly in the center. Let cool slightly.
  7. In a saucepan over medium heat, combine sugar and a splash of water until dissolved. Add chopped nuts and cook until bubbly and golden, stirring continuously. Remove from heat.
  8. Drizzle the praline sauce over your cooled pie and serve.

Notes

For the perfect custard texture, whisk well and monitor baking time closely. Pair with vanilla ice cream or whipped cream.
